Artist: Thomas Rhett Single: "Make Me Wanna" Writers: Thomas Rhett, Bart Butler, Larry McCoy Album: It Goes Like ThisLabel: Valory Music Company Add Date: August 4th, 2014 SourceChart Run: 58* - 50* - 45* - 45* - 42* - 41* - 41* - 38* - 36* - 33* - 33* - 31* - 25* - 24* - 23* - 21* - 20* - 18* - 15* - 11* - 10* - 8* - 6* - 4* - 3* - 2* - 1* - 2 - 6 (Mediabase)
